Rebecca has been a licensed massage therapist since March of 2009, working for spas, chiropractors, and in wellness centers. She opened Mind & Body Wellness in 2010 in the hopes that it would grow into a holistic landmark for those seeking tranquility and respite in this busy city setting. Her preferred modality of massage is Thai, which makes its way into most every treatment, and her specialties are in injury rehabilitation and musculoskeletal imbalances. With her extensive knowledge of human anatomy, physiology, and kinesiology, her work has been best described as 'corrective', but her spa experience adds an element of comfort and luxury to each treatment.
